China Dynamics inks MoU with Eastern Ferry to supply new energy ferryboats made of aluminium alloy

According to a recent report, China Dynamics Limited has entered into a strategic business cooperation agreement with Eastern Ferry Company Limited, with the intention of jointly promoting the development of green marine transportation in Hong Kong.
As per the memorandum of understanding that they have signed, China Dynamics plans to supply new energy ferryboats to Eastern Ferry, ensuring to meet environmental protection and energy-saving requirements for marine vessels in Hong Kong. A preliminary round of discussions has taken place between the two parties, and now they believe that they should pursue further negotiation before undergoing formal procurement agreement.
The Hong Kong Government intends to include certain terms in order to encourage ferry operators to use environmentally-friendly vessels and equipment, which in turn will reduce pollution emissions.
The new energy ferry boat to be supplied by China Dynamics will have a body made of fiberglass or aluminium alloy and sail at a speed of three to five knots between Aberdeen and Ap Lei Chau. The total accommodation capacity of the boat will be 30 passengers.
Earlier, China Dynamics had signed a cooperation agreement with China Shipbuilding Industry Corporation to pursue research and development of electric boats and ferryboats for Hong Kong. The Group owns core technologies of new energy vehicles, supported by its R&D centres in Beijing, Tianjin, Shenzhen, and Dongguan, and operates a new energy automobile industrial base in Wulong, Chongqing.
On signing the MoU with Eastern Ferry, Mr. Cheung Ngan, Chairman of China Dynamics, said, “We are delighted to sign the MOU with Eastern Ferry, as it means we are moving closer to a formal procurement agreement. The MOU also marks our success of extending the application of new energy technology from automobiles to boats. The first electric boat to set sail in Hong Kong will also likely be the first pure electric ferryboat in the city, charting the course for the city’s green shipping development.”
